Richard Stanway 076cd5d5d4 UI: Add option to hide OBS windows on Windows
This uses the SetWindowDisplayAffinity API to hide windows from capture
applications (including OBS). This is not perfect - internal windows
such as context menus, combo box dropdowns, etc will still be displayed.
Even with these limitations, it should help people with single monitors
capture content with less interference from the OBS window.

This implementation is for Windows only but the code is generic enough
that adding other platforms should be straightforward.

#pragma once
#include <util/c99defs.h>
#include <string>
#include <vector>
class QWidget;
/* Gets the path of obs-studio specific data files (such as locale) */
bool GetDataFilePath(const char *data, std::string &path);
/* Updates the working directory for OSX application bundles */
bool InitApplicationBundle();
std::string GetDefaultVideoSavePath();
std::vector<std::string> GetPreferredLocales();
bool IsAlwaysOnTop(QWidget *window);
void SetAlwaysOnTop(QWidget *window, bool enable);
bool SetDisplayAffinitySupported(void);
#ifdef _WIN32
uint32_t GetWindowsVersion();
uint32_t GetWindowsBuild();
void SetAeroEnabled(bool enable);
void SetProcessPriority(const char *priority);
void SetWin32DropStyle(QWidget *window);
bool DisableAudioDucking(bool disable);
struct RunOnceMutexData;
class RunOnceMutex {
RunOnceMutexData *data = nullptr;
public:
RunOnceMutex(RunOnceMutexData *data_) : data(data_) {}
RunOnceMutex(const RunOnceMutex &rom) = delete;
RunOnceMutex(RunOnceMutex &&rom);
~RunOnceMutex();
RunOnceMutex &operator=(const RunOnceMutex &rom) = delete;
RunOnceMutex &operator=(RunOnceMutex &&rom);
};
RunOnceMutex GetRunOnceMutex(bool &already_running);
QString GetMonitorName(const QString &id);
#endif
#ifdef __APPLE__
void EnableOSXVSync(bool enable);
void EnableOSXDockIcon(bool enable);
void InstallNSApplicationSubclass();
void disableColorSpaceConversion(QWidget *window);
void CheckAppWithSameBundleID(bool &already_running);
bool ProcessIsRosettaTranslated();
#endif
#ifdef __linux__
void RunningInstanceCheck(bool &already_running);
#endif
#if defined(__FreeBSD__) || defined(__DragonFly__)
void PIDFileCheck(bool &already_running);
#endif
